Rep. Barry Moore, who represents Alabama’s 2nd district in the U.S. Congress, recently posted a series of messages on his official X (formerly Twitter) account addressing national events and expressing support for various causes.
On August 25, 2025, Moore wrote: “President Trump is fighting for these families to get the answers they deserve. God bless them and his leadership.”
The following day, on August 26, he posted: “Make Cracker Barrel great again!”
On August 27, Moore addressed a recent tragedy in Minneapolis with a call for prayers: “I hope you will join Heather and I in praying for the victims of the horrific shooting in Minneapolis and their loved ones. May God be with them.”
Barry Moore has served as a member of the U.S. Congress since 2021 after replacing Martha Roy. Before his tenure in Congress, he was a member of the Alabama House of Representatives from 2010 to 2018. Born in Coffee County, Alabama in 1966, Moore resides in Enterprise and graduated from Auburn University with a Bachelor of Science degree in 1992.
